WebMar 2, 2024 · Alt + H + O + R will get you to the Rename Sheet command in the Home tab. Pressing the Alt key will activate the hotkeys in the ribbon. Then pressing H will select the Home tab. Pressing O will select the Format command and then pressing R will select the Rename Sheets option from the Format command.
